PHP使用PDO調(diào)用mssql存儲過程的方法示例
本文實例講述了PHP使用PDO調(diào)用mssql存儲過程的方法。分享給大家供大家參考,具體如下:
數(shù)據(jù)庫中已創(chuàng)建存儲過程user_logon_check, PHP調(diào)用示例如下,
<?php $dsn = 'mssql:dbname=MyDbName;host=localhost'; $user = 'sa'; $password = '666666'; try { $dbCon = new PDO($dsn, $user, $password); } catch (PDOException $e) { print 'Connection failed: '.$e->getMessage(); exit; } $username = '123'; $userpsw = '123'; //$xp_userlogon = $dbCon ->query("exec user_logon_check '$username','$userpsw'"); //mysql->call user_logon_check('$username','$userpsw'); //mysql->call user_logon_check(?,?) $xp_userlogon = $dbCon->prepare('exec user_logon_check ?,?'); $xp_userlogon->bindParam(1,$username); $xp_userlogon->bindParam(2,$userpsw); $xp_userlogon->execute(); $uCol = $xp_userlogon->columnCount(); echo $uCol."<br>"; while($row = $xp_userlogon->fetch()){ for( $i=0; $i<$uCol; $i++ ) print $row[$i]." "; print "<br>"; } ?>
更多關(guān)于PHP相關(guān)內(nèi)容感興趣的讀者可查看本站專題:《PHP基于pdo操作數(shù)據(jù)庫技巧總結(jié)》、《php+Oracle數(shù)據(jù)庫程序設(shè)計技巧總結(jié)》、《PHP+MongoDB數(shù)據(jù)庫操作技巧大全》、《php面向?qū)ο蟪绦蛟O(shè)計入門教程》、《php字符串(string)用法總結(jié)》、《php+mysql數(shù)據(jù)庫操作入門教程》及《php常見數(shù)據(jù)庫操作技巧匯總》
希望本文所述對大家PHP程序設(shè)計有所幫助。
相關(guān)文章
深入PHP empty(),isset(),is_null()的實例測試詳解
本篇文章是對PHP empty(),isset(),is_null()的實例測試進(jìn)行了詳細(xì)的分析介紹,需要的朋友參考下2013-06-06PHP實現(xiàn)找出鏈表中環(huán)的入口節(jié)點
這篇文章主要介紹了PHP實現(xiàn)找出鏈表中環(huán)的入口節(jié)點,涉及php針對環(huán)形鏈表的遍歷、查找、計算等相關(guān)操作技巧,需要的朋友可以參考下2018-01-01PHP正則表達(dá)式替換站點關(guān)鍵字鏈接后空白的解決方法
這篇文章主要介紹了PHP正則表達(dá)式替換站點關(guān)鍵字鏈接后空白的問題解決,需要的朋友可以參考下2014-09-09PHP面向?qū)ο蠓治鲈O(shè)計的經(jīng)驗原則
你不必嚴(yán)格遵守這些原則,但你應(yīng)當(dāng)把這些原則看成警鈴,若違背了其中的一條,那么警鈴就會響起 , ----- Arthur J.Riel2008-09-09原生JS實現(xiàn)Ajax通過GET方式與PHP進(jìn)行交互操作示例
這篇文章主要介紹了原生JS實現(xiàn)Ajax通過GET方式與PHP進(jìn)行交互操作,涉及javascript ajax交互及php數(shù)據(jù)接收、處理與數(shù)據(jù)庫查詢相關(guān)操作技巧,需要的朋友可以參考下2018-05-05PHP圖像處理之使用imagecolorallocate()函數(shù)設(shè)置顏色例子
這篇文章主要介紹了PHP圖像處理之使用imagecolorallocate()函數(shù)設(shè)置顏色例子,本文給出了十進(jìn)制和十六進(jìn)制2種設(shè)置顏色的方法,需要的朋友可以參考下2014-11-11